A vertical aerial pano consists of multiple images that are stitched together to create one single vertical panorama. It’s a unique perspective that you can’t achieve with one single shot.
You must shoot manual mode if you want to have complete over the exposure while taking a vertical pano. In this video, I dive into some aspects of manual mode. Then I show you how to capture a vertical pano while flying your drone.
I’ll show you how to capture the vertical pano on a Mavic 2 pro, but the same principles will apply for most of the DJI series.
